Environmental Compliance Inspector (Full-Time)

MBP (McDonough Bolyard Peck) is seeking an Environmental Compliance Inspector to support projects across Western Virginia. The role involves inspecting construction activities for environmental compliance, reporting noncompliance, and providing technical guidance during site visits related to erosion and sediment control and storm water management.

Responsibilities

Perform daily record keeping of project activities related to environmental compliance
Monitor and perform environmental inspections to verify regulatory compliance
Report identified noncompliance observations from ESC and SWM inspections
Provide technical guidance during site visits related to ESC measures, SWM BMPs, SWPPP, Spill Containment Plans, C-107 process, VSMP, ESCCC, and MS4 programs
Interpret and apply state and federal environmental laws, regulations, policies, and best practices during inspection activities

Required

Minimum of 2 years with state and federal environmental regulations, including ESC measures, SWM BMPs, SWPPP, Spill Containment Plans, C-107 process, VSMP, ESCCC, and MS4 programs
High school graduate
Virginia DEQ Erosion and Sediment Control Inspector Certification (required)
Virginia DEQ Storm Water Management Inspector Certification (required)
Valid driver's license and acceptable driving record
Background screening will be performed
Applicants must be authorized to work in the U.S. without sponsorship

Preferred

OSHA 10-Hour or OSHA-30 Safety Training
